Output 3d114ccf67186340634f6f730130ff8da3d7d29de213a26f60a546b6a2acdbfe:12

value
8314328
script pubkey
OP_HASH160 OP_PUSHBYTES_20 343a4a9bd10821ab77465319f3782516f57a4a3a OP_EQUAL
address
36TAtgM4vaMtXzvjEDv8dvsnEjoNVbygPH
transaction
3d114ccf67186340634f6f730130ff8da3d7d29de213a26f60a546b6a2acdbfe
spent
true